Lexus RC F vs Mercedes-Benz G-Class — Depreciation

Mercedes-Benz G-Class holds its value better — 79% five-year retention against 77% for the Lexus RC F. Resale value and cost of ownership, head to head.

On five-year value retention the Mercedes-Benz G-Class comes out ahead, holding about 79% of its value versus 77% for the Lexus RC F. Over the first five years the Mercedes-Benz G-Class loses roughly $29,459 while the Lexus RC F loses about $21,350 — a gap near $-8109.

First-year drop is the biggest factor: the Mercedes-Benz G-Class sheds about 4% in year one versus 3% for the Lexus RC F. If you buy used, the steeper early drop is what the original owner absorbs.
